Excitement around Gadar 3 continues to grow as director Anil Sharma has offered a promising update on the much-awaited third instalment of the iconic franchise. After the massive success of Gadar: Ek Prem Katha (2001) and Gadar 2 (2023), fans are eagerly waiting for Sunny Deol to reprise his legendary role as Tara Singh once again.

According to Anil Sharma, the team is currently focused on developing the script for Gadar 3. He confirmed that the writing process is underway and that production will begin only once they are fully satisfied with the final story. The director also hinted that the film is likely to go on floors by the end of 2026, depending on the completion of the scripting phase.
Sharma further explained that the team is taking time to ensure the story lives up to the legacy of the franchise. He emphasized that Gadar has always connected deeply with audiences and that maintaining its emotional core is a key priority for the makers. The goal, he said, is to preserve the same intensity and cultural impact that made the earlier films so successful.
Speaking about his filmmaking approach, Sharma shared that he always prioritizes audience expectations over everything else. He described his creative process as thinking like a viewer first rather than a filmmaker, ensuring that the story resonates with people sitting in single-screen theatres. According to him, if a story does not excite the audience, it does not belong in the film.

The Gadar franchise has remained one of the most iconic in Indian cinema. The original film, set against the backdrop of India’s Partition, became a cultural phenomenon and achieved cult status over the years. Its sequel, Gadar 2, recreated box-office history by reviving the emotional journey of Tara Singh and Sakeena for a new generation.
With Sunny Deol and Ameesha Patel expected to return, anticipation for Gadar 3 is already at a peak. While details about the plot and cast are still under wraps, fans are hopeful that the next chapter will continue the legacy of one of Bollywood’s most beloved film franchises.
